ABR Input Status Command
Output Field
iplinkstat
ipsignal
inputrate
netname
netid
transid
scrambmode
lsttunerea
tunereason
freqmode

Description
ABR Ethernet link status
Type: String
Values: "Down", "Up"
ABR Signal Encapsulation Lock Status
Type: String
Values: "None", "Active"
Bit rate of the input transport stream
Type: Float
Values: 0...4294.967295 Mbps
Network Name
Type: String
Values: Up to 64 characters
Network ID
Type: Integer
Values: 0...65535
Transport ID
Type: Integer
Values: 0...65535
Scrambling Mode
Type: String
Values: "Unk", "DES", "DVB", "BISS1", "BISS2", or "BISS3"
Last Tune Reason
Type: String
Values: "No_Change", "DR Change", "User_Change",
"Preset_Change", "Uplink_Change", or "NIT_TS_Change"
Last Tune Reason
Type: String
Values: Up to 24 characters
Frequency Tuning Mode
Type: String
Values: "NIT", "User Cfg"
